He also directed 17 Navy training films and did the narration for The Fighting Lady, a documentary about an aircraft carrier. Robert Taylor's passing at the age of 84 on Friday, February 11, 2022 has been publicly announced by Cox Funeral Home - Barberton in Barberton, OH.Legacy invites you to offer condolences and share mem During the 1940s, Barbara was working all the time, says Callahan. An experienced amateur pilot, he was sworn as a lieutenant in the Navys air transport division but was deferred until he completed Song of Russia at M-G-M. He was celebrated for his strapping good looks and his reputation for being a reliable, clean-cut actor. television series, the 1959-62 The Detectives. As the upstanding, no-nonsense sleuth, he reminded viewers that he also had played a hard-fisted venal detective in the 1954 film Rogue Cop. He also appeared on other TV shows, including Death Valley Days., Off-screen Mr. Taylor lead a singularly unglamorized, scandal-free life. Im still like a race horse when a picture starts.
